    The Final Cut is a satire or criticism of the British Government and how they treated their troops as they returned from war. "Maggie" is the UK's government (Margret Thatcher) in the album. After World War 2, they didn't have programs to help their troops recover or assimilate back into normal society. I see no similarities between the Final Cut and Syd Barrett. Its strictly Roger Water's criticism of War, Margret Thatcher, and how troops are treated.

  • The Wall was released in 1979. The movie the wall was released in 1982. When Pink is in the stall, he is singing part of "Your Possible Pasts" off the album, the final cut, which was released in 1983. After this, he sings "The Moment of Clarity", which was released on Roger's solo album in 1984.

    Also, why the security guard is washing his hands, you can heard Mc Atmos talking in the backround, accouncing the beginning of The Wall Live 1980 "Is There Anybody Out There".
